Two 20 microfarad capacitors are wired in parallel with each other in series with a single 5 ohm resistor. The previously described circuit branch is in parallell with a circuit branch with a 5 milliHenry inductor and 10 ohm resistor in series. A six volt battery powers the circuit.

A. When the capacitor has half of its final charge, what is the current through the inductor?

B. What is the maximum energy stored in the capacitor?
